How they compare
Norway currently reports 142,269 1000 USD against 128,507 1000 USD in Slovenia, a difference of 13,762 1000 USD.
That makes Norway's figure about 1.1 times Slovenia's.
The two have swapped places 10 times across 33 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Norway ahead.
Norway ranks 40th and Slovenia ranks 42nd of 234 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Norway averaged higher in 3 and Slovenia in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Norway | Slovenia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 64,974 1000 USD | 38,470 1000 USD | 26,503 1000 USD | Norway |
| 2000s | 91,290 1000 USD | 88,384 1000 USD | 2,906 1000 USD | Norway |
| 2010s | 100,472 1000 USD | 113,599 1000 USD | 13,127 1000 USD | Slovenia |
| 2020s | 145,069 1000 USD | 138,155 1000 USD | 6,914 1000 USD | Norway |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
